msdyn_journalline EntityType

Unposted business transaction line details.

Entity Set Path
[organization URI]/api/data/v9.0/msdyn_journallines
Base Type
Display Name
Journal Line
Primary Key
Primary Key Attribute
Operations Supported


Properties represent fields of data stored in the entity.Some properties are read-only.

Name Type Details
createdon Edm.DateTimeOffset

Date and time when the record was created.

Display Name: Created On

Read Only
exchangerate Edm.Decimal

Exchange rate for the currency associated with the entity with respect to the base currency.

Display Name: Exchange Rate

Read Only
importsequencenumber Edm.Int32

Sequence number of the import that created this record.

Display Name: Import Sequence Number

modifiedon Edm.DateTimeOffset

Date and time when the record was modified.

Display Name: Modified On

Read Only
msdyn_accountingdate Edm.DateTimeOffset

Display Name: Accounting Date

msdyn_amount Edm.Decimal

Shows the amount of the journal line.

Display Name: Amount

msdyn_amount_base Edm.Decimal

Value of the Amount in base currency.

Display Name: Amount (Base)

Read Only
msdyn_amountmethod Edm.Int32

Select the calculation method for the amount.

Display Name: Amount Method

Default Options
Value Label
690970000 Tax Calculation
192350000 Multiply Quantity By Price
192350001 Fixed Price
192350002 Multiply Basis Quantity By Price
192350003 Multiply Basis Amount By Percent
msdyn_basisamount Edm.Decimal

Enter the basis amount of the journal line.

Display Name: Basis Amount

msdyn_basisamount_base Edm.Decimal

Value of the Basis Amount in base currency.

Display Name: Basis Amount (Base)

Read Only
msdyn_basisprice Edm.Decimal

Enter the basis price of the journal line.

Display Name: Basis Price

msdyn_basisprice_base Edm.Decimal

Value of the Basis Price in base currency.

Display Name: Basis Price (Base)

Read Only
msdyn_basisquantity Edm.Decimal

Enter the basis quantity of the journal line.

Display Name: Basis Quantity

msdyn_billingstatus Edm.Int32

Display Name: Billing Status

Default Options
Value Label
690970000 Work order closed - posted
192350004 Ready to Invoice
192350000 Unbilled Sales Created
192350001 Customer Invoice Created
192350002 Customer Invoice Posted
192350003 Canceled
msdyn_billingtype Edm.Int32

Select the billing type for the journal line.

Display Name: Billing Type

Default Options
Value Label
192350000 Non Chargeable
192350001 Chargeable
192350002 Complimentary
192350003 Not Available
msdyn_customertype Edm.Int32

Shows the type of customer.

Display Name: Customer Type

Default Options
Value Label
192350001 Account
192350002 Contact
msdyn_description Edm.String

The name of the custom entity.

Display Name: Description

msdyn_documentdate Edm.DateTimeOffset

Enter the transaction date of the journal line.

Display Name: Document Date

msdyn_enddatetime Edm.DateTimeOffset

Enter the end date and time.

Display Name: End Date/Time

msdyn_exchangeratedate Edm.DateTimeOffset

Display Name: Exchange Rate Date

msdyn_externaldescription Edm.String

The external description of the journal line.

Display Name: External Description

msdyn_isposted Edm.Boolean

Shows whether the journal has been submitted.

Display Name: Is Posted

Default Options
Value Label
1 Yes
0 No
msdyn_journallineid Edm.Guid

Unique identifier for entity instances

Display Name: Journal Line

msdyn_percent Edm.Decimal

Enter the percent.

Display Name: Percent

msdyn_price Edm.Decimal

Enter the price.

Display Name: Price

msdyn_price_base Edm.Decimal

Value of the Price in base currency.

Display Name: Price (Base)

Read Only
msdyn_quantity Edm.Decimal

Enter the quantity.

Display Name: Quantity

msdyn_salescontractline Edm.String

(Deprecated) Shows the project contract line.

Display Name: (Deprecated) Project Contract Line

msdyn_startdatetime Edm.DateTimeOffset

Enter the start date and time.

Display Name: Start Date/Time

msdyn_transactionclassification Edm.Int32

Select the transaction class.

Display Name: Transaction Class

Default Options
Value Label
690970000 Commission
690970001 Additional
192350000 Time
192350001 Expense
192350002 Material
192350003 Milestone
192350004 Fee
690970002 Tax
msdyn_transactiontypecode Edm.Int32

Display Name: Transaction Type

Default Options
Value Label
192350000 Cost
192350004 Project Contract
192350005 Unbilled Sales
192350006 Billed Sales
192350007 Resourcing Unit Cost
192350008 Inter-Organizational Sales
msdyn_vendortype Edm.Int32

Display Name: Vendor Type

Default Options
Value Label
192350001 Account
192350002 Contact
overriddencreatedon Edm.DateTimeOffset

Date and time that the record was migrated.

Display Name: Record Created On

statecode Edm.Int32

Status of the Journal Line

Display Name: Status

Default Options
Value Label
0 Active
1 Inactive
statuscode Edm.Int32

Reason for the status of the Journal Line

Display Name: Status Reason

Default Options
Value Label
1 Active
2 Inactive
timezoneruleversionnumber Edm.Int32

For internal use only.

Display Name: Time Zone Rule Version Number

utcconversiontimezonecode Edm.Int32

Time zone code that was in use when the record was created.

Display Name: UTC Conversion Time Zone Code

versionnumber Edm.Int64

Version Number

Display Name: Version Number

Read Only

Lookup Properties

Lookup properties are read-only, computed properties which contain entity primary key Edm.Guid data for one or more corresponding single-valued navigation properties. More information: Lookup properties and Retrieve data about lookup properties.

Name Single-valued navigation property Description
_createdby_value createdby

Unique identifier of the user who created the record.

_createdonbehalfby_value createdonbehalfby

Unique identifier of the delegate user who created the record.

_modifiedby_value modifiedby

Unique identifier of the user who modified the record.

_modifiedonbehalfby_value modifiedonbehalfby

Unique identifier of the delegate user who modified the record.

_msdyn_accountcustomer_value msdyn_AccountCustomer

Shows the customer for the journal line.

_msdyn_accountvendor_value msdyn_AccountVendor
_msdyn_bookableresource_value msdyn_bookableresource

Shows the resource.

_msdyn_contactcustomer_value msdyn_ContactCustomer
_msdyn_contactvendor_value msdyn_ContactVendor
_msdyn_contractorganizationalunitid_value msdyn_contractorganizationalunitid

Unique identifier for Organizational Unit associated with Journal Line.

_msdyn_journal_value msdyn_Journal

Shows the name of the journal.

_msdyn_pricelist_value msdyn_PriceList

Shows the price list used for the journal line.

_msdyn_product_value msdyn_Product

Select the product.

_msdyn_project_value msdyn_Project

Select the project.

_msdyn_resourcecategory_value msdyn_ResourceCategory

Select the resource role.

_msdyn_resourceorganizationalunitid_value msdyn_ResourceOrganizationalUnitId

Organizational unit at the time the entry was registered of the resource who performed the work.

_msdyn_salescontract_value msdyn_SalesContract

Shows the project contract.

_msdyn_salescontractlineid_value msdyn_SalesContractLineId

Unique identifier for Project Contract Line associated with Journal Line.

_msdyn_task_value msdyn_Task

Select the project task.

_msdyn_transactioncategory_value msdyn_TransactionCategory

Select the transaction category.

_msdyn_unit_value msdyn_Unit

Shows the unit of measurement.

_msdyn_unitschedule_value msdyn_UnitSchedule

Shows the unit schedule.

_ownerid_value ownerid

Owner Id

_owningbusinessunit_value owningbusinessunit

Unique identifier for the business unit that owns the record

_owningteam_value owningteam

Unique identifier for the team that owns the record.

_owninguser_value owninguser

Unique identifier for the user that owns the record.

_transactioncurrencyid_value transactioncurrencyid

Shows the currency associated with the entity.

Single-valued navigation properties

Single-valued navigation properties represent lookup fields where a single entity can be referenced. Each single-valued navigation property has a corresponding partner collection-valued navigation property on the related entity.

Name Type Partner
createdby systemuser lk_msdyn_journalline_createdby
createdonbehalfby systemuser lk_msdyn_journalline_createdonbehalfby
modifiedby systemuser lk_msdyn_journalline_modifiedby
modifiedonbehalfby systemuser lk_msdyn_journalline_modifiedonbehalfby
msdyn_AccountCustomer account msdyn_account_msdyn_journalline_AccountCustomer
msdyn_AccountVendor account msdyn_account_msdyn_journalline_AccountVendor
msdyn_bookableresource bookableresource msdyn_bookableresource_msdyn_journalline_bookableresource
msdyn_ContactCustomer contact msdyn_contact_msdyn_journalline_ContactCustomer
msdyn_ContactVendor contact msdyn_contact_msdyn_journalline_ContactVendor
msdyn_contractorganizationalunitid msdyn_organizationalunit msdyn_msdyn_organizationalunit_msdyn_journalline_ContractOrganizationalUnitId
msdyn_Journal msdyn_journal msdyn_msdyn_journal_msdyn_journalline_Journal
msdyn_PriceList pricelevel msdyn_pricelevel_msdyn_journalline_PriceList
msdyn_Product product msdyn_product_msdyn_journalline_Product
msdyn_Project msdyn_project msdyn_msdyn_project_msdyn_journalline_Project
msdyn_ResourceCategory bookableresourcecategory msdyn_bookableresourcecategory_msdyn_journalline_ResourceCategory
msdyn_ResourceOrganizationalUnitId msdyn_organizationalunit msdyn_organizationalunit_journalline
msdyn_SalesContract salesorder msdyn_salesorder_msdyn_journalline_SalesContract
msdyn_SalesContractLineId salesorderdetail msdyn_salesorderdetail_msdyn_journalline
msdyn_Task msdyn_projecttask msdyn_msdyn_projecttask_msdyn_journalline_Task
msdyn_TransactionCategory msdyn_transactioncategory msdyn_msdyn_transactioncategory_msdyn_journalline_TransactionCategory
msdyn_Unit uom msdyn_uom_msdyn_journalline_Unit
msdyn_UnitSchedule uomschedule msdyn_uomschedule_msdyn_journalline_UnitSchedule
ownerid principal owner_msdyn_journalline
owningbusinessunit businessunit business_unit_msdyn_journalline
owningteam team team_msdyn_journalline
owninguser systemuser user_msdyn_journalline
transactioncurrencyid transactioncurrency TransactionCurrency_msdyn_journalline

Collection-valued navigation properties

Collection-valued navigation properties represent collections of entities which may represent either a one-to-many (1:N) or many-to-many (N:N) relationship between the entities.

Name Type Partner
msdyn_journalline_Annotations annotation objectid_msdyn_journalline
msdyn_journalline_AsyncOperations asyncoperation regardingobjectid_msdyn_journalline
msdyn_journalline_BulkDeleteFailures bulkdeletefailure regardingobjectid_msdyn_journalline
msdyn_journalline_DuplicateBaseRecord duplicaterecord baserecordid_msdyn_journalline
msdyn_journalline_DuplicateMatchingRecord duplicaterecord duplicaterecordid_msdyn_journalline
msdyn_journalline_MailboxTrackingFolders mailboxtrackingfolder regardingobjectid_msdyn_journalline
msdyn_journalline_PrincipalObjectAttributeAccesses principalobjectattributeaccess objectid_msdyn_journalline
msdyn_journalline_ProcessSession processsession regardingobjectid_msdyn_journalline
msdyn_journalline_SyncErrors syncerror regardingobjectid_msdyn_journalline
msdyn_msdyn_journalline_msdyn_projectapproval_referencejournalline msdyn_projectapproval msdyn_referencejournalline


The following operations can be used with the msdyn_journalline entity type.

Name Binding
GrantAccess Not Bound
IsValidStateTransition Not Bound
ModifyAccess Not Bound
RetrievePrincipalAccess Not Bound
RetrieveSharedPrincipalsAndAccess Not Bound
RevokeAccess Not Bound


The following solutions include the msdyn_journalline entity type.

Name Description
Project Service Automation Microsoft Dynamics 365 for Project Service Automation is an end-to-end solution that helps sales and delivery teams engage customers and deliver billable projects on time and within budget. Project Service gives you the tools you need to: Estimate, quote, and contract work; Plan and assign resources; Enable team collaboration; Capture time, expense, and progress data for real-time insights and accurate invoicing.

See also